Security analysts within enterprises are living a nightmare that never ends. 24 hours a day, their organizations are being attacked by outside (and sometimes inside) perpetrators – hackers, hacktivists, competitors, disgruntled employees, etc. Attacks range in scope and sophistication, but are always there, haunting the security teams tasked with guarding against them.

To cope with this never-ending, ever-changing slew of threats, most organizations rely on established best practices to help them mitigate as many incidents as possible within the 24 hour or less window given to thwart most attacks.
